Message type: E = Error
Message class: RSCRM - RSCRM: Messages
Message number: 187
Message text: Query does not contain variables

- Query does not contain variables ?The SAP error message RSCRM187: Query does not contain variables typically occurs in the context of SAP BW (Business Warehouse) when you are trying to execute a query that is expected to have variables defined, but none are present. This can happen in various scenarios, such as when you are trying to run a query in the BEx Analyzer or in the SAP BW Query Designer.
Cause:
- Missing Variables: The query you are trying to execute does not have any variables defined, which are necessary for filtering or parameterizing the data.
- Incorrect Query Design: The query might have been designed without considering the need for variables, or the variables may have been removed or not activated.
- Execution Context: The context in which you are trying to execute the query may not support the use of variables, or the variables may not be properly configured.
Solution:
Check Query Design:
- Open the query in the Query Designer.
- Verify if any variables are defined for the query. If not, you may need to add them.
- Ensure that the variables are correctly configured (e.g., input parameters, default values).
Add Variables:
- If the query requires variables, you can add them by selecting the relevant characteristics in the Query Designer and defining the variables accordingly.
- Make sure to set the properties of the variables, such as whether they are mandatory or optional.
Test the Query:
- After adding or modifying variables, save the query and test it again to see if the error persists.
Check Execution Context:
- Ensure that you are executing the query in a context that supports the use of variables. For example, if you are using a specific tool or interface, verify that it is compatible with the query design.
